Yng Lvcas, born Daniel Oswaldo Donlucas Martínez on October 24, 1999, hails from Guadalajara, Jalisco, Mexico. His journey into music began at a young age. He first discovered his passion for performing during a school musical. This experience ignited his desire to become an artist.
As a teenager, Yng Lvcas explored various creative outlets. He dabbled in acting, dancing, DJing, and vlogging. However, his true calling emerged when he began writing and composing music. By the age of 15, he was already crafting his own songs, influenced by the vibrant sounds of rap and corridos.
In 2015, he took a significant step into the music scene. He immersed himself in the reggaeton and Latin trap genres, drawing inspiration from renowned artists like Bad Bunny, Arcángel, and Anuel AA. Over the next several years, he honed his craft, experimenting with different styles and sounds. He dedicated himself to perfecting his music, preparing for the moment when he could share it with the world.
Despite facing skepticism from many, Yng Lvcas remained determined. He started his career with limited resources, often working behind the camera to create his early music videos. With the support of his family, he invested in equipment and learned the technical skills needed to produce his content. This foundation set the stage for his future success.

In 2021, Yng Lvcas released his first EP, Wup? Mixtape1, featuring corridos. However, it was his reggaeton track, La Bebe, that truly captured attention. The song's catchy beat and engaging lyrics resonated with listeners, leading to its viral success on platforms like TikTok. This momentum propelled him to release the full reggaeton album, LPM, later that same year.
The remix of La Bebe, featuring Peso Pluma, marked a significant milestone in his career. Released in March 2023, the remix quickly climbed the charts, peaking at number 11 on the Billboard Hot 100. This achievement showcased Yng Lvcas's ability to connect with a broad audience and solidified his status as a rising star in the music industry.
